Transfer Time definition
Examples of Transfer Time in a sentence
In the case of any Inactive Employee who becomes a Transferred Employee following the day after the Employee Leasing End Date, all references in this Agreement to the Transfer Time shall be deemed to be references to 12:01 a.m. on the date that such individual becomes a Transferred Employee.
For the avoidance of doubt, Purchaser shall be responsible for any Liabilities of Purchaser from (A) any Transferred Employee termination of employment by Purchaser on or after the Transfer Time or (B) any Transferred Employee’s resignation from employment with Purchaser on or after the Transfer Time.
If the Workers’ Compensation Event occurs over a period both preceding and following the Transfer Time, the claim shall be the joint responsibility and Liability of Seller Group and Purchaser and shall be equitably apportioned between Seller Group, on the one hand, and Purchaser, on the other hand, based upon the relative periods of time that the Workers’ Compensation Event transpired preceding and following the Transfer Time.
Effective as of the Transfer Time, each Transferred Employee shall cease to be an employee of any member of Seller Group and shall cease to participate in any Business Employee Benefit Plan, except to the extent applicable Law requires otherwise.
Seller and Purchaser intend that the Transferred Employees will have continuous and uninterrupted employment immediately before the Transfer Time with the Seller Group and immediately after the Transfer Time with Purchaser.
